Historical Context

For much of the U.S. rail industry's history, the industry and especially its freight rates were heavily regulated by the Interstate Commerce Commission (ICC). All rates were published in tariffs subject to ICC approval and were regularly challenged by shippers to further delay their actual implementation.

When the Interstate Highway System was built in the late 50's and early 60's, long haul trucking exploded. Increased highway competition radically changed the U.S. transportation landscape to trucks from rail, a shift that the railroads and ICC refused to acknowledge. Within a decade multiple major railroad bankruptcies and a near collapse of the industry were the consequence of business lost to motor carriers due to high regulated rates and dismal service.
